Dementia

Dementia is a collective term for cognitive disorders primarily affecting memory, thinking, and reasoning. It is not a specific disease but a syndrome, with Alzheimer's disease being the most common cause, accounting for approximately 60-80% of cases. Other types include vascular dementia, Lewy body dementia, and frontotemporal dementia. Dementia affects millions worldwide, particularly older adults, though it is not a normal part of aging.
The progression of dementia is generally gradual.

Cognitive impairment as predictor of functional dependence in an elderly sample.

José Carlos Millán-Calenti1, Javier Tubío, Salvador Pita-Fernández

  • 1Gerontology Research Group, Faculty of Health Sciences, University of A Coruña, Campus de Oza, E-15006, A Coruña, Spain. jcmillan@udc.es

Archives of Gerontology and Geriatrics
|March 15, 2011
PubMed
Summary

Cognitive decline predicts functional dependence in older adults. This study shows that reduced cognitive status significantly increases the risk of needing help with daily activities, highlighting its importance in care planning.

Area of Science:

  • Gerontology
  • Neuroscience
  • Public Health

Background:

  • Functional dependence in older adults is a growing concern.
  • Cognitive decline is increasingly recognized as a significant factor affecting daily living.
  • Understanding the relationship between cognition and daily function is crucial for effective elder care.

Purpose of the Study:

  • To determine if cognitive decline predicts functional dependence in community-dwelling older adults.
  • To examine the association between cognitive status and dependence in basic and instrumental activities of daily living (ADL and IADL).
  • To assess the influence of cognitive status on functional dependence, independent of other variables.

Main Methods:

  • Retrospective study of 600 community-dwelling individuals aged 65 and older.
  • Logistic regression analysis to assess the association between cognitive status (MMSE scores) and functional dependence.
  • Control for socio-demographic variables, age, educational level, and health conditions.

Main Results:

  • Cognitive status significantly predicted functional dependence in both basic (OR=4.1) and instrumental (OR=5.7) activities of daily living.
  • Cognitive impairment was linked to dependence in specific basic (e.g., bathing) and instrumental (e.g., managing finances) activities.
  • A gradual relationship was observed: greater cognitive decline correlated with a higher loss of ability to perform activities, particularly basic ones.

Conclusions:

  • Cognitive decline is an independent predictor of functional dependence in older adults.
  • Cognitive assessment can serve as a valuable tool to identify individuals needing support.
  • These findings underscore the importance of addressing cognitive health to maintain functional independence in aging populations.
